On this episode, we meet with award-winning filmmaker, writer, educator, and President of the International Bateson Institute, Nora Bateson. Nora brings us beyond the descriptions of the physical scie...nce that underpins our predicament to the nuance and perception of the complexity that we live within. How can we improve our relationships with others, as well as the broader world? Nora helps us understand how systems dynamics inform our predicament. How does an ecosystem develop and mature through mutual learning? What are ways we can apply this thinking to our profit-focused superstructure? About Nora Bateson Nora Bateson is an award-winning filmmaker, writer and educator, as well as President of the International Bateson Institute, based in Sweden. Her work asks the question "How can we  improve our perception of the complexity we live within, so we may improve our interaction with the world?" An international lecturer, researcher and writer, Nora wrote, directed and produced the award-winning documentary, An Ecology of Mind, a portrait of her father, Gregory Bateson. Her work brings the fields of biology, cognition, art, anthropology, psychology, and information technology together into a study of the patterns in ecology of living systems. Her book, Small Arcs of Larger Circles, released by Triarchy Press, UK, 2016 is a revolutionary personal approach to the study of systems and complexity. Starting point is 00:24:40 We'll get to that. So getting to your work, Nora. So can you explain what is warm data? Where did the name come from? And what does gathering warm data look like? Warm data. The name came from a phrase my father used to use when he would talk about warm ideas. And a warm idea was an idea that was actually not isolated from its relational process.
Starting point is 00:25:13 Right? So he asked the question, what is the pattern that connects? And that's a warm idea. What would be a cold idea? A cold idea would be a compartmentalized deliverable definition that isolates something from its nest of relational process. Right? So a cold idea is one that it separates. And when that separation happens, it actually leads to more. more separation, which is sort of different than when you are looking at a warm idea is going to invite you into exploring relational process. And that just leads you to more relational process. So it's a study of relationships that lead to more relationships instead of divisions that lead to more divisions.

We are having a beautiful conversation. Let me get to one of your core phrases. I believe your father invented this term. I'm not sure. But what is schismogenesis? And how is that relevant to our current
Starting point is 00:53:35 cultural situation. Schismogenesis. Okay, schismo is to break. And Genesis is to make, to, to become, to birth. And so schismogenesis is an important study of how systems fall apart. And we've been talking mostly about how systems come together. But I think at the edge of our conversation this whole time has been the threat of system collapse, system breakdown, system destruction. And so my dad talked about two different kinds of schismogenesis.
Starting point is 00:54:21 And what's important about schismogenesis is it's a way of looking at patterns of relational process that lead to things falling up. part. Okay. It's always in relationship. Even when we're breaking relationship, we do it with relationship. So what are those kinds of relationships that break relationship? And I think this is a very important question right now because it's what we're seeing all around is, is things coming to pieces. So let me give a brief description. This is not easy stuff. So, I'll just try to, you know, take it easy on it. But there's two kinds that my dad talked about. One was complimentary. And complementary is where you have a relationship that is complement. Right. So one party, it might be more dominant. One party might be more submissive. One party might be authoritative.
Starting point is 00:55:25 One party might be more demure. One party is more. And that kind of relationship could be parent teacher, could be employer employee, could be in a marriage, could be parent-child, could be, right, all sorts of relationships, you know, person and dog. And that you could perceive that because of an understanding of the way in which the relationship is different, it's very creative. All sorts of great things can happen in that relationship. But over time, the one that is more authoritative or dominating or influential becomes more so. And the one that is more submissive or more demure or more compromising becomes more so.
Starting point is 00:56:13 And pretty soon the gap between them grows to the point that there's actually no more relationship. So a positive feedback loop squeezes out the lesser of the two, so to speak. Well, it squeezes out the actual relationship itself. The second version is symmetrical schismogenesis. And symmetrical is where the parties are at the same. They're more equal and they're in competition. So you would get symmetrical schismogenesis in, you can have it in a marriage, right? So, you know, you get a new book deal and your partner needs to get a new job.
Starting point is 00:56:54 And then, you know, they get a new job. And so you have to get a new, get a TV show. And then, you know, you get into a competition. It could be an arms race. It could be a, you know, sibling rivalry. So you get into a symmetrical schismogenesis. And that, again, can be very creative. All sorts of good stuff can come out of that.
Starting point is 00:57:20 So the first kind was called what? Complementary. So complementary. schismogenesis results in the relationship actually disappearing. But symmetrical actually is a positive feedback on the relationship itself. So the relationship has an arms race and there's creativity. Could be good or could be bad. But the two still coexist.
Starting point is 00:57:45 Yeah. It might start off good. And then over time, there's nothing left but the competition. All the other aspects of the relationship that may. made it juicy and wonderful and fun and playful get lost and you just get caught in the competition in the one-upping and then you lose everything else that you have to be in relationship about so again it gets it gets lost and the third kind is really interesting this was developed by a finish group not my dad and it's called systems holdback and systems holdback
Starting point is 00:58:24 is where I don't put into the relationship what I could put into the relationship because I know that you're not putting into the relationship what you could put into the relationship. You don't put in what you could because you know that I'm not. And so eventually you get the relationship becomes devitalized. There's nothing there. There's nothing there to make relationship with because we're holding back everything. And this, again, you might see with employers and employees. You could see it in a marriage.
Starting point is 00:58:59 You could see it in a friendship. You could see it in all sorts of ways. And I want to be clear that all three of these forms of schismogenesis can absolutely coexist in the same relationship. So how is the term schismogenesis relevant to our current cultural situation?
